Advances in Stem Cell Therapy for Kidney Repair and Recovery

Stem cell therapy holds promising potential for kidney repair and recovery. Scientists explore the use of stem cells to regenerate damaged kidney tissue, potentially restoring function and preventing the need for dialysis or transplantation. Ongoing research investigates the safety and efficacy of various stem cell types, including embryonic, induced pluripotent, and adult stem cells.

Mesenchymal Stem Cells for Cartilage Regeneration in Shoulder Injuries

Mezenkimal kök hücreler (MSC'ler) exhibit remarkable potential for cartilage regeneration in shoulder injuries. Their ability to differentiate into chondrocytes, secrete growth factors, and modulate inflammation offers promising therapeutic avenues. Recent studies have explored the use of MSCs in surgical procedures and injectable therapies, demonstrating their efficacy in restoring cartilage integrity and reducing pain.
